What you said is correct. The problem is that active managers buy more of good companies and less of bad companies. Passive funds/managers just buy everything.

So in a world dominated by passive funds, shitty companies get as much capital (which they waste) as good companies. Something that's sorta functionally communism.

>will make bad decisions and go under
Or they just keep limping along. Because by being included in an index (just a matter of getting your company past a certain size threshold) and having passive funds buy $X of stock from every company on that index, your company gets roughly $X/[number of companies in that index] every year.

Again, it's a lot like bad companies that communist countries are notorious for propping up.
